vb通用中判断是不是素数

来源:学生作业帮助网 编辑:作业帮 时间:2024/05/25 17:12:35
vb通用中判断是不是素数
麻烦帮忙做下列vb题:1.编写一个判断素数的函数;并在单选按钮的单击事件过程中,用inputbox输入数据,再调

第一题答案:OptionExplicitPrivateSubCommand1_Click()DimnAsIntegern=Val(InputBox("请输入一个数"))Ifisprime(n)Then

试用VB程序语言写出主要程序段:判断一个给定的数X是否是素数

判断n是否为素数,可用n除以2到根号n之间所有的整数,除不尽则n为素数Fora=2ToInt(Sqr(n))IfnModa0Then'余数不为0,则n为素数isprime=True'n为素数Elsei

求VB编程代码:判断一个数是否是素数?

判断素数的原理是:素数是只能被1和本身整除的数.例如3只能被1和3整除,17只能被1和17整除等等,想9就不是素数(能被1,3,9整除).编程的算法是:穷举法,就是将需要判断的数除2、除3.一直除到这

用Vb编写一个程序,要求从键盘输入一个正整数M,自动判断并显示M中有哪些数可以分为两个相等的素数.

dimi,j,n,tasintegern=inputbox("n=")fori=1tonifimod2=0thent=i\2forj=2toint(sqrt(t))iftmodt=othenexitf

VB实训 判断一个数是否为素数

Fori=2Tox-1IfxModi=0ThenExitForNextiIfi=xThenPrintx;

C语言中怎么判断素数

从1开始遍历到该数的开方,如果找到一个数能整除该数,证明这不是个素数,看看以下代码#include//头文件为math.hintisprime(inta){inti;for(i=2;i再问:for(i

取n位正整随机数并判断是否为素数的vb

privatefunctionFun_RandNum(RandNumasinteger)asboolean'True为是素数,False为不是素数.dimk,iasintegeri=int(sqrt(

写VB程序:用函数过程来判断一个数是否为素数

DimxAsInteger,iAsIntegerx=InputBox("请输入你要判断的数字")Ifx

VB编程:判断任意正整数N是否为素数

PrivateSubCommand1_Click()n=Text1.TextFori=2ToInt(Sqr(n))IfnModi=0Thenmsgbox"不是"ExitSubEndIfNextimsg

用vb判断输入1 to 1000是否为奇数,偶数,素数

定义三个listboxOptionExplicitPrivateSubForm_Click()DimiAsLong,jAsLongList1.AddItem("奇数")List2.AddItem("偶

VB;编写一个判断素数的通用函数,计算1350到2460内所有素数的和 下星期要交了

OptionExplicit'请在窗体中加入一个按钮和一个文本框'这是判断是否为素数的函数,n为需要判断的数'返回值为逻辑型,True表示为素数,False表示不是素数FunctionIsPrime(

判断89951是不是素数,并说明理由

不是素数,因为89951=293*307

如何用C++判断一个数是不是质数(素数)

当前的这个数如果能够被比他小的数整除(n%i==0),返回0(return0)说明它不是质数,如果从2一直到比他小1的数都不能被整除说明这个数不能被任何数整除当然就是质数了return1

java 判断是不是素数

判断number是否是素数有这么几种方法:(1)用2至number-1之间的所有数去整除number,如果有一个能被整除,说明number是非素数;除非所有的数都不能被整除,才说明number是素数.

如何判断一个数是不是素数

如果n不是素数,那么n必有介于1和n之间的约数,设为a,a和n/a中有一个不大于n^0.5,检验一个即等于检验了另一个

这是我学VB看到的一个小程序:判断一个大于或等于3的正整数是不是一个素数.

subformclick_()dimnasintegern=inputbox("请输入数")k=int(spr(n))i=2swit=0‘令swit=0接下来的意思是N除以小于N的输如果能被整除SWI

用VB 能否判断一个11位数是否为素数,即用VB能否设计出程序证明费马对于素数的猜想是错误的,QUICKBASIC

quickbasic好像不行.32位正整数最大不过10位,如果你不做两个整数变量串联就无法计算更大的数..NET的ULong类型能够计算最大20位,18,446,744,073,709,551,615